aboutsummaryrefslogtreecommitdiff
path: root/original/uapi/linux/xfrm.h
diff options
context:
space:
mode:
Diffstat (limited to 'original/uapi/linux/xfrm.h')
-rw-r--r--original/uapi/linux/xfrm.h3
1 files changed, 2 insertions, 1 deletions
diff --git a/original/uapi/linux/xfrm.h b/original/uapi/linux/xfrm.h
index 23543c3..6a77328 100644
--- a/original/uapi/linux/xfrm.h
+++ b/original/uapi/linux/xfrm.h
@@ -4,6 +4,7 @@
#include <linux/in6.h>
#include <linux/types.h>
+#include <linux/stddef.h>
/* All of the structures in this file may not change size as they are
* passed into the kernel from userspace via netlink sockets.
@@ -33,7 +34,7 @@ struct xfrm_sec_ctx {
__u8 ctx_alg;
__u16 ctx_len;
__u32 ctx_sid;
- char ctx_str[];
+ char ctx_str[] __counted_by(ctx_len);
};
/* Security Context Domains of Interpretation */